Cloudy and fizzy amber colored ale without much head formation.

The scent is underwhelming. Not much just a little sweet wheat malt and a little citrus from C type hops.

Taste is a little sweet wheat malt and decent bitterness. A deep and long lasting bready aftertaste and a hint of citrus too. C hops gets stronger as you drink it and it is quite a good version of the American style wheat beer, but not an outstanding one.

Mouthfeel is per the style.

A good lunch or thirst quenching beer and a low alcohol one too. A little better than average.

Had one of these at Downtown's stand at the Santa Barbara Beer Festival.

A - Golden orange, cloudy body. Good off-white head.
S - I can't smell anything, not a thing.
T - Very subtle hops, wheat malt, very smooth. Lightly spicy.
M - Very light mouthfeel.
D - Extremely drinkable. Slides down the throat all-too-well.
